Splurge Or Save… On A Blue Leather / Faux Leather Moto Jacket!


I started off 2013 on the hunt for a moto jacket, something that I wouldn’t normally be attracted to for my wardrobe, but I like the idea of adding an edgy piece to my usually ladylike outfits. However, I’ve yet to find the perfect jacket for me, but the hunt is on. In the mean time, I’m inspired by the latest trend in blue leather moto jackets which I’ve been seeing at every price point, perfect for a new Splurge or Save? post! I would recommend adding a moto jacket over a sheath dress with peep toe pumps, to dress up a maxi dress & gladiator flats, or for a graphic tee & skinny jeans with knee boots.

I’m starting this post off with the Jil Sander leather jacket ($3,050.00) from Nordstrom, which is of course made from the highest quality craftsmanship. Its sleek minimalist design calls on a mix of menswear-inspiration & utilitarianism chic. Next, the moto leather jacket ($450.00) from True Religion is a 100% lamb leather design with cool zipper details & a contemproary cut.

At a much more reasonable price, @Macy’s, you can find the INC International Concepts faux-leather classic motorcycle jacket ($89.50). Forth, I’ve selected the (minus the) leather crop biker jacket ($76.80) from Express, which is currently 40% off its original $128.00 price tag. Lastly, @Forever 21, the stitched faux leather jacket ($42.80) is a comparable & budget-friendly topper.
